Is offshore wind energy a viable renewable technology option in Malta?

In the Maltese NECP, neither onshore nor offshore wind energy are included as a viable renewable technology option contributing to Malta’s renewable energy objectives for the EU’s 2030 target (NECP, 2019). 1. Site selection process

Is solar PV a viable source of RES-E in Malta?

Solar PV is the most viable source of RES-E in Malta. It is projected to contribute to 42% of Malta’s RES contribution in 2030. However, also other renewable energy sources are supported in the country through tenders. Malta’s target for the RES- E sector is 11% by 2030 (NECP, pg. 40-41).

Should photovoltaic units be mandatory?

The measure is aimed at raising the percentage of energy that is produced from renewable sources. The government has to date been encouraging the installation of photovoltaic units through incentives such as feed-in tariffs but this would be the first time that their installation would become mandatory.

Who is eligible for energy subsidies in Malta?

Eligible are new photovoltaic installations and new wind energy installations, which have not benefitted from other support. Tenders for small installations - Malta has a premium tariff, which is awarded through a tender held by the Ministry for Energy and Water Management.
